Our analysis found University of Florida to be the most popular school for chemistry students who want to pursue a doctor’s degree in Florida. UF is a fairly large public school located in the midsize city of Gainesville.
Of the 33 students majoring in chemistry at UF, 58% are male and 42% are female.

Out of the 8 schools in Florida that were part of this year’s ranking, Florida State University landed the # 2 spot on the list. Located in the city of Tallahassee, Florida State is a public school with a very large student population.
Of the 20 students majoring in chemistry at Florida State, 55% are male and 45% are female.
